Braves News: Fish fry in Miami, 2026 schedule released, and more

The Atlanta Braves got back in the win column after Tuesday night’s 11-2 victory over the Miami Marlins. Hurston Waldrep got the ball and in 5.1 innings allowed one run on eight hits. It wasn’t his best stuff considering he did not record any strikeouts, but his outing was still effective given he surrendered just one run.

Offensively, the bats came to life in the top of the ninth, where the Braves recorded nine of their runs. Ozzie Albies came up huge with four RBI on the night.

The Braves go for the series win this afternoon at 1:10 ET.

More Braves News:

The 2026 schedule was released Tuesday, and for the first time since 2022, the Braves are opening up at home.

The Braves came in at No. 7 on MLB Pipeline’s Top 10 Pitching Prospects List.

MLB News:

The Los Angeles Dodgers placed reliever Alex Vesia on the 15-day injured list with a right oblique strain. The move is retroactive to August 23.

St. Louis Cardinals first baseman Willson Contreras has received a six-game suspension after his behavior in Monday night’s contest with the Pittsburgh Pirates.

The Houston Astros reinstated OF/DH Yordan Alvarez from the 60-day injured list. He has been out since May with a hand injury.

The Philadelphia Phillies placed right-hander Jordan Romano on the 15-day injured list due to right middle finger inflammation.

Texas Rangers right-hander Nathan Eovaldi is likely done for the season due to a rotator cuff strain.
